IPasearch & ClickHouse: Latest News & Updates

by Jhon Lennon 46 views

Hey everyone! Today, we're diving deep into the exciting world of IPasearch and ClickHouse, two powerhouses in the data analytics and search realms. Whether you're a seasoned data pro, a curious developer, or just someone looking to stay ahead of the curve, you've come to the right place. We're going to break down what's new, what's hot, and what you absolutely need to know about these incredible technologies. Get ready to get your geek on, because we're covering all the juicy details, from performance boosts to killer new features that will make your data sing. So, grab your favorite beverage, get comfy, and let's explore the latest happenings in the universe of IPasearch and ClickHouse!

Unpacking IPasearch: What's New with This Powerful Search Engine?

Alright guys, let's kick things off with IPasearch. If you're not already familiar, IPasearch is a seriously robust search engine library that's been making waves for its speed and flexibility. The core idea behind IPasearch is to provide developers with a powerful, yet easy-to-integrate search solution for their applications. Think about building your own custom search functionality, indexing vast amounts of data, and getting lightning-fast results – that's the IPasearch promise. Lately, the buzz around IPasearch has been about its continuous evolution, focusing on enhancing performance, improving relevance, and expanding its compatibility. Developers are constantly looking for ways to optimize search experiences, and IPasearch has been listening. Recent updates have focused on streamlining indexing processes, meaning you can get your data into the search index faster and more efficiently than ever before. This is a huge deal for applications that deal with real-time data or large, frequently updated datasets. Imagine a news aggregator or an e-commerce platform; any delay in indexing can mean users are missing out on the latest information or products. IPasearch's team has been working tirelessly to shave off precious milliseconds, and sometimes even seconds, from indexing times. Furthermore, the relevance algorithms have seen some smart tuning. It's not just about finding documents that contain your keywords; it's about finding the best documents that match your user's intent. This involves sophisticated ranking mechanisms, understanding synonyms, and handling complex queries with grace. We've seen improvements in how IPasearch handles natural language queries, making it feel more intuitive for end-users. For developers, this translates into less time spent tweaking relevance settings and more time building awesome features. Another key area of development has been expanding the supported data types and structures. IPasearch is becoming even more versatile, allowing for richer data to be indexed and searched. Whether you're dealing with structured data, unstructured text, or even geospatial information, IPasearch is aiming to be your go-to solution. The community around IPasearch is also growing, fostering a collaborative environment where bugs are squashed quickly, and new features are proposed and implemented. This open-source spirit is vital, and it means IPasearch is constantly being refined by a passionate group of users and contributors. So, if you're looking to supercharge your application's search capabilities, keep a very close eye on IPasearch – its ongoing development is setting new benchmarks for speed, relevance, and adaptability in the search engine landscape. It's all about making search smarter, faster, and more accessible for everyone.

ClickHouse Chronicle: The Latest Buzz from the Columnar Database Giant

Now, let's shift gears and talk about ClickHouse. If you're in the big data game, you know ClickHouse. It's the lightning-fast, open-source columnar database management system that's designed for online analytical processing (OLAP). What does that even mean? Basically, it's built to crunch massive amounts of data incredibly quickly, making it perfect for real-time analytics, business intelligence, and log analysis. The news coming out of the ClickHouse camp is always exciting, and recently, there's been a strong emphasis on performance optimization and usability enhancements. For starters, the core engine continues to be refined for even faster query execution. Think about complex analytical queries that used to take minutes or even hours – ClickHouse aims to bring those down to seconds or milliseconds. This relentless pursuit of speed is achieved through clever data compression, efficient data storage (remember, it's columnar!), and advanced query processing techniques like vectorized query execution. Developers and data engineers are constantly pushing the boundaries of what's possible with data analysis, and ClickHouse is right there with them, providing the horsepower needed to keep up. One of the most significant areas of recent development has been around data ingestion. Getting data into ClickHouse efficiently is just as crucial as querying it quickly. Updates have focused on improving throughput for streaming data, making it easier to integrate ClickHouse into real-time data pipelines. Whether you're ingesting logs from thousands of servers, tracking user interactions on a popular website, or processing sensor data from IoT devices, ClickHouse is getting better and better at handling the firehose of incoming information without breaking a sweat. This means less waiting, more analyzing. Furthermore, the team has been working hard on usability and developer experience. While ClickHouse has always been powerful, making it accessible to a wider audience is a key goal. This includes improvements to the SQL dialect, better error messages, enhanced tooling, and more comprehensive documentation. For instance, new functions are regularly added to the SQL language, providing more power and flexibility for complex data transformations and aggregations directly within the database. We're also seeing a push towards better integration with popular data ecosystems, making it easier to connect ClickHouse with other tools you might be using, like Apache Spark, Flink, or various business intelligence platforms. The community is a massive driving force behind ClickHouse. Active development means new features are constantly being tested and released, often driven by real-world use cases. Bug fixes are frequent, and performance enhancements are ongoing. This vibrant ecosystem ensures that ClickHouse remains at the cutting edge of analytical database technology. So, whether you're already a ClickHouse power user or just starting to explore its capabilities, keep your eyes peeled for the latest updates. The pace of innovation is astounding, and ClickHouse continues to solidify its position as a leader in high-performance OLAP databases. It's truly a game-changer for anyone dealing with large-scale data analysis.

The Synergy: How IPasearch and ClickHouse Work Together

Now, the really exciting part, guys: how do IPasearch and ClickHouse play together? While they are distinct technologies with different primary functions – IPasearch for fast, flexible search and ClickHouse for high-speed analytical queries on massive datasets – their synergy can be absolutely game-changing for certain applications. Imagine a scenario where you have a colossal amount of user-generated content, perhaps forum posts, product reviews, or support tickets. You need to be able to search through this content quickly and analyze trends and patterns within it. This is where the magic happens. You could use ClickHouse as your primary data warehouse, storing all this unstructured and semi-structured text data. ClickHouse excels at handling these large volumes and performing aggregations, like counting the number of reviews mentioning a specific feature or analyzing sentiment over time. However, querying raw text for relevance and natural language understanding can be challenging for traditional analytical databases. This is where IPasearch shines. You can leverage IPasearch to index the textual content from your ClickHouse data. When a user performs a search, the query first hits IPasearch, which, thanks to its optimized indexing and ranking algorithms, returns the most relevant documents almost instantaneously. These relevant documents could then be linked back to their original records in ClickHouse. But it goes a step further. The results from IPasearch can then be enriched by pulling in related analytical data from ClickHouse. For example, if a user searches for a specific product review, IPasearch finds the most relevant reviews. Then, you can query ClickHouse to show aggregate sales data for that product, or trending topics related to the keywords found in the review. This combined approach offers the best of both worlds: the speed and relevance of a dedicated search engine for user-facing queries, and the analytical power and scalability of an OLAP database for deep data insights. Think of applications like e-commerce platforms where users search for products and need to see related analytics, or customer support portals where agents need to find relevant past tickets quickly and then see aggregated customer feedback. It’s about creating a seamless experience where both rapid information retrieval and profound data exploration are possible. The integration often involves using ClickHouse to store the primary data and metadata, while periodically indexing the searchable text fields into IPasearch. ETL (Extract, Transform, Load) processes would be key here, ensuring that data flowing into ClickHouse is also processed and indexed by IPasearch. This dual-engine architecture allows you to build sophisticated applications that cater to both the immediate needs of search users and the analytical demands of business stakeholders. It’s a powerful combination that unlocks new possibilities for data-driven innovation.

Key Features and Performance Improvements

Let's drill down a bit more into the specific enhancements and features that are making waves in both IPasearch and ClickHouse. For IPasearch, the focus has been heavily on making it even more developer-friendly and performant. We're talking about significant speed boosts in indexing, which as we’ve touched upon, is crucial. New indexing strategies have been implemented that can reduce the time it takes to add new documents to the index, sometimes by a remarkable margin. This means applications can stay more up-to-date with less effort. Furthermore, query performance is seeing continuous refinement. IPasearch is employing more aggressive caching mechanisms and optimizing its query planner to ensure that search results are not just relevant, but also delivered with minimal latency. For developers, this translates to fewer resources needed to achieve high search throughput. The API surface is also being expanded, offering more granular control over indexing and querying, making it easier to integrate IPasearch into complex workflows. Think about features like enhanced synonym handling and sophisticated stemming algorithms that go beyond simple word matching to truly understand user intent. For ClickHouse, the performance gains are always front and center. Recent releases have brought improvements in query execution speed for certain types of complex analytical queries, particularly those involving window functions or intricate joins. The columnar nature of ClickHouse is its superpower, and ongoing work focuses on optimizing data encoding and decoding to squeeze out every bit of performance. For instance, new data compression codecs are being introduced that offer better compression ratios, leading to reduced storage footprint and faster data reads. In terms of features, ClickHouse is expanding its functional capabilities. We're seeing the addition of new built-in functions for data manipulation, aggregation, and statistical analysis, making it possible to perform more complex operations directly within the database. Support for newer SQL standards is also improving, making it more familiar to developers coming from other relational database backgrounds. Moreover, the operational aspects of ClickHouse are being enhanced. This includes better tools for monitoring, debugging, and managing large clusters, as well as improvements in replication and fault tolerance, ensuring that your analytical workloads remain available even in challenging environments. Both projects are also seeing a strong emphasis on community contributions and ecosystem integration. Updates are often driven by the needs of users facing real-world problems, leading to practical and impactful enhancements. The drive towards better interoperability with other data tools means that IPasearch and ClickHouse are becoming even more valuable components in a modern data stack.

Future Trends and What to Expect

Looking ahead, the trajectory for both IPasearch and ClickHouse points towards even greater integration, enhanced intelligence, and broader adoption. For IPasearch, expect a continued push towards smarter search. This means deeper integration of machine learning techniques to improve relevance ranking, understand user intent more accurately, and even provide proactive search suggestions. We might see advancements in semantic search capabilities, moving beyond keyword matching to understanding the meaning behind queries. Think about searching for a concept rather than just words. Performance will remain a key focus, with ongoing optimizations for indexing and querying speed, especially as data volumes continue to explode. Developer experience will also likely see further improvements, with more intuitive APIs, better tooling, and streamlined integration processes. The goal is to make powerful search capabilities accessible to an even wider range of developers and applications. For ClickHouse, the future is all about scalability and real-time intelligence. We'll likely see continued improvements in its ability to handle even larger datasets and higher ingestion rates, making it the go-to choice for mission-critical real-time analytics. Expect more sophisticated analytical functions, potentially including advanced time-series analysis, geospatial capabilities, and even built-in support for machine learning inference directly within queries. The trend towards making ClickHouse more accessible will also continue, with ongoing efforts to simplify deployment, management, and querying, perhaps through enhanced GUI tools or more abstract interfaces. The integration with other parts of the data ecosystem will undoubtedly deepen, making ClickHouse a seamless fit within modern data platforms. The synergy between IPasearch and ClickHouse is also likely to evolve. As both technologies mature, we can expect more streamlined ways to combine their strengths, enabling developers to build incredibly powerful applications that offer both lightning-fast search and deep, real-time analytical insights. Perhaps we'll see tighter integrations, or even specialized connectors designed to maximize their combined potential. The overarching trend is clear: data is becoming more central to every business, and technologies like IPasearch and ClickHouse are at the forefront, providing the tools needed to unlock its full value. Keep watching these space, guys – the innovation is relentless and the possibilities are endless!

So there you have it! A deep dive into the latest news and updates for IPasearch and ClickHouse. It's an exciting time for data technology, and these two are leading the charge. Stay tuned for more updates and happy analyzing! πŸ˜‰